Nestled in the desolate desert off Highway 15 between California and Las Vegas lies ZZYZX ROAD, where a seemingly idyllic hot springs destination called Soda Springs Resort is concealing a dark, twisted reality. This resort serves as a sanctuary for beings evolved from primordial pools of...something. They resemble humans but harbor a sinister secret: they can absorb and replace unsuspecting humans in a grotesque cycle of parasitism.

Ellis, a blind woman equipped with bionic eyes, arrives at the resort seeking clarity and escape from her chaotic life, haunted by voices and a sense of alienation. As she immerses herself in the surreal world of Soda Springs, she discovers that the staff claim that they possess the means to cure her blindness.

As Ellis undergoes her transformative experience, the narrative explores the dichotomy of euphoria and dissociation that accompanies her immersion in the resort's pools. The resort staff, many of whom grapple with their own malevolence, engage in acts that blur the lines between survival and violence, all while treating their twisted performances as a “show.”

The resort becomes a backdrop for Ellis’s exploration of her identity and the psychological toll of transformation. The pools symbolize the beings' connection to their origins and serve as a catalyst for her journey. As Ellis navigates this chaotic environment, she confronts the deeper implications of her metamorphosis and what it means to be both human and something else entirely.

Ripple is a tale of transformation, existential dread, and the quest for connection in an increasingly alien world. With immersive prose that captures Ellis’s unique perspective, the novel weaves together elements of body horror and a sharp commentary on society and identity, leading to a thought-provoking exploration of what it means to truly see oneself.
